Community Supported Agriculture (CSA) Program Expansion at Huerta del Valle Community Garden

Technical Assistance and Education/Outreach Outreach and Education
IERCD partnered with Huerta del Valle Community Garden (HdV), an Ontario-based urban farm and community garden to expand its Community-Supported Agriculture (CSA) Program via the hiring of a CSA Coordinator at IERCD. The CSA Coordinator's tasks include expanding subscriptions to CSA boxes distributed by HdV; implementing public workshops on nutrition, soil health, and other similar educational topics; and coordinating with IERCD staff to implement NRCS Conservation Practices at HdV.
